Arbore explores material hybrids and regional narratives in latest collection

'In the centre of your household we want you to enjoy our table together with your loved ones'

Founded on a multi-generational trajectory, Romanian furniture brand Arbore traces its formal beginning to 1999, though its operational and cultural roots stretch back to 1972. Emerging from a Transylvanian context defined by family-led entrepreneurship, the company evolved out of a local workshop founded by Elena Birtoc and her three sisters. Today, Arbore is run by the third generation of the family and operates as a brand positioned at the intersection of Eastern European craftsmanship and broader European design markets.

New material direction through design collaboration
The company's ISRA collection marks a shift in visual language and collaboration strategy. Designed by Șerban Georgescu of ISRA Design, the collection combines Romanian oak with marble and metal accents, referencing an "Industrial Luxury" style not previously explored by Arbore.

'While we remain grounded in our core philosophy of good-hearted simplicity, this collection explores new creative terrain,' Vlad said, describing the fusion of traditional wood craft with engineered finishes. The move aligns with growing industry interest in hybrid materiality and mixed typologies, particularly within high-use residential and hospitality settings.

Market dynamics and spatial applications
Arbore's strongest presence remains in Western Europe, particularly the UK and France, though Vlad notes rising engagement in Romania and Eastern Europe, where increased interest in locally-produced, design-forward furniture is supporting growth in both private and commercial segments.

One reference project, the Old Sessions House by Knotel in London, demonstrated Arbore's capacity to operate within adaptive reuse frameworks. 'Our furniture played a key role in creating a warm, tactile atmosphere that elevated the user experience,' Vlad noted.

While the company maintains a generalist stance across typologies, it continues to centre its identity on dining and meeting environments, spaces associated with cultural continuity and architectural narrative.

Production adaptability and future positioning
Responding to increased demand for customisation and material variation, Arbore has integrated a high level of adaptability across its production systems, including modular wood finishes and textile options. This operational shift is supported by technical upgrades to their factory facilities, allowing for more complex manufacturing processes without displacing manual craft techniques.

Looking ahead, Arbore plans to remain present at key European fairs such as Maison & Objet (Paris), Salone del Mobile (Milan), and is preparing for Habitat Valencia 2026, citing the Spanish market as an emerging area of focus.

'We invite your audience to explore the new wave of emerging Eastern European design brands,' Vlad concluded. 'There's a vibrant creative energy in this region, shaped by deep-rooted craftsmanship and a fresh, honest approach to design.'
